With a DMP, you make one month-to-month settlement to the credit history counseling company. Those funds are after that distributed to creditors of your unsafe debts, such as charge card and installment finances. The company deals with your creditors to minimize rate of interest or waive costs, however some lenders may reject such concessions.

A financial obligation consolidation lending combines your qualified financial obligations right into one new loan. It can aid you pay for financial debt if you have the ability to safeguard a finance rate that's reduced than the ordinary price of the accounts you're consolidating. However, you should refrain from acquiring financial debt on those freshly cleared accounts or your financial debt can grow even higher.

You might need it if your lender or a collection company ever attempts to accumulate on the financial obligation in the future. When a lending institution forgives $600 or even more, they are called for to send you Type 1099-C.

Debt forgiveness or negotiation generally hurts your credit report. Anytime you work out a debt for much less than you owe, it may show up as "cleared up" on your credit rating report and influence your credit history for 7 years from the date of settlement. Your debt can additionally drop significantly in the months causing the forgiveness if you fall behind on repayments.

Tax obligation debt concession programs Tax obligation financial debt occurs when the amount of taxes you owe surpasses what you have actually paid. This circumstance frequently arises from underreporting earnings, not submitting returns promptly, or disparities found throughout an IRS audit. The effects of collecting tax debt are severe and can include tax liens, which offer the internal revenue service a lawful claim to your residential or commercial property as safety and security for the debt.

Earnings and Bank Accounts Internal revenue service can impose (confiscate) wages and financial institution accounts to please the financial obligation. Building Seizure In severe cases, the Internal revenue service can confiscate and sell home to cover the financial debt.

The application procedure for a Deal in Compromise includes a number of thorough steps. Initially, you have to complete and send IRS Form 656, the Deal in Compromise application, and Kind 433-A (OIC), a collection information declaration for individuals. These types need extensive economic details, including details regarding your revenue, financial debts, expenses, and possessions.

Back tax obligations, which are overdue tax obligations from previous years, can significantly raise your overall IRS financial obligation otherwise addressed quickly. This debt can build up passion and late settlement charges, making the original amount owed much bigger in time. Failing to pay back tax obligations can lead to the IRS taking enforcement activities, such as releasing a tax obligation lien or levy versus your building.

It is necessary to address back taxes immediately, either by paying the sum total owed or by arranging a layaway plan with the internal revenue service. By taking aggressive actions, you can prevent the build-up of additional passion and fines, and protect against extra hostile collection actions by the IRS.
